The transformation

From hidden momentum to visible market proof.

Before

LEGALFLY had proof, but the market saw fragments.

  • Customer proof was not always easy to find.
  • Product updates could feel like isolated announcements.
  • Founder and team insight was under-leveraged.
  • Events and webinars were not always turned into durable assets.
  • Reporting did not yet look like a visible growth loop.
->
After

Proof became packaged, repeated and easier to trust.

  • Named customer stories gave buyers concrete credibility.
  • Product workflow content made value easier to see.
  • People-led posts made the company feel more human.
  • Events, webinars and market commentary created authority.
  • Monthly reporting showed what to repeat and improve.

Why it matters in legal AI

Legal AI buyers do not only need to know that a product exists. They need to believe the company understands legal workflows, handles trust properly, has serious customers, and is part of a bigger workflow shift.

Buyer belief that content should support

LEGALFLY is not just another AI tool. It is a credible legal AI operating layer for real legal workflows.

That is the kind of belief LinkedIn should help build before sales conversations happen.
